Ice Meaning in English

التعريف

Frozen water, usually found as cubes or a layer, used to cool things or as a natural solid form.

الاستخدام والفروق الدقيقة

'Ice' is uncountable when referring to the substance ('some ice'), but 'an ice' can be used for ice cream or frozen treats (mainly UK). Common collocations: 'ice cube,' 'on the rocks' (with ice, for drinks), 'black ice' (dangerous thin layer on roads). Also used metaphorically: 'break the ice' (start a conversation).
